Nic D also known as “The Gardener" is planting his seeds of inspirational and thought-provoking messages by combining his clever lyrics with a mainstream sound. Though his main audience is in the states, his impact doesn’t end there. He is quickly growing fanbases across Europe and Brazil. He has quickly gained 500,000+ plays across Spotify, Apple Music, and YouTube. Nic writes all of his lyrics but, his creative vision isn’t limited to music. He also directs and edits all of his music videos and edits all of his social media and marketing photos. 



The opening moments of Nic D’s latest track “Real Life” lays out a certain type of gentle scene, Nic’s vocals bring melody and an easy-going, descending pattern that suits the entrancing calm of the soundscape. Contrast rules here, those melodic moments are hypnotic, you walk away humming that tune, and the consistent groove of the track offers an equally lingering effect that’s well-received. Nic D knows how to write something that sticks with you. While this release eans towards catchy urban-pop with a fairly vintage twist in some respects, the ultimate effect is that it leaves its mark with you indefinitely, a true sign of an effective songwriter.

Can your fans expect a new music video to match?

This year I have been putting out a single with a music video every 2 weeks. For the “Real Life” music video I had fans submit footage of themselves dancing and singing to the song. I wanted the people who support me to have an opportunity to be creative and create something with me. The result was something very organic and special for me.


What do you hope your listeners take away from your music?

Whether people listen to my music on a regular basis or are just hearing it for the first time, I always hope they pay attention to the lyrics. I put a lot of energy and thought into what i say in my songs. I strive to always have a message or a piece of knowledge that I believe to be true. 


Other than making music, how else does your creativity manifest?

I own a photography and cinematography company so, I’m constantly creating. I edit all of my own music videos and take part in the directing process as well.
